Many parents in Phoenix and nearby areas like Glendale, Peoria, Tempe, Scottsdale, and Surprise often ask an important question: Is it safe to use Uber or Lyft for kids?
While rideshare platforms like Uber and Lyft are convenient for adults, they are not specifically designed for children’s school transportation. Understanding how these services work and their limitations can help parents make safer decisions.
How Uber and Lyft Work for Transportation
Uber and Lyft operate on a gig-based driver model. Drivers log in and accept rides on demand, which means drivers can change frequently.
This model works well for adults who need flexible transportation, but it creates challenges for children:
No guarantee of the same driver each day
Drivers may not have experience with children
No structured daily routine
Limited oversight compared to dedicated services
For children, especially younger students, consistency and familiarity are very important.

Are Uber and Lyft Designed for Kids?
The short answer is no.
Uber and Lyft are built for general public use, primarily for adults. In most cases, riders are expected to be at least 18 unless accompanied by an adult.
This means:
They are not designed for independent child transportation
They do not provide consistent drivers
They are not built around school schedules
Because of this, using rideshare services for daily school transportation may not be the most reliable or safe option.
